HR Generalist - People & Culture Administrator

Location: Northern Italy or Central-Southern Italy, with a housing contribution of up to €2,000 gross per month for 18 months and reimbursement of relocation expenses.

Employment terms: Permanent contract, full-time, 40 hours per week across five days, with availability for shifts from Monday to Sunday. The role is classified at the third level of the ConfCommercio Commerce, Distribution and Services collective agreement, with a gross annual salary of €28,500 paid over 14 months.

About the role

Reporting to the Store P&C Business Partner, you will manage People & Culture processes for a store with at least 100 colleagues, with increasing autonomy and responsibility.

  • Administration: entering attendance data, managing shift changes, sickness, holidays and payslips.
  • Organisation: understanding scheduling principles, supporting managers with schedules based on commercial needs and organising holiday plans.
  • Recruitment: publishing vacancies, screening CVs and interviewing candidates for sales assistant roles.
  • Training: managing new colleague training, induction processes and development plans.
  • Safety: organising mandatory training, reporting, personal protective equipment and emergency plans.
